St. John : A Dream Destination In The U.S. Virgin Islands

They offer all of the beauty, luxury and exclusivity of the Caribbean, but with the safety and security that comes with being under the jurisdiction of the U.S. Of the three major U.S. Virgin Islands, St. John is often referred to the least, but this is because it has resisted the temptation to overdevelop and commercialize itself, and not because it is a less worthy destination than St. Croix or St. Thomas.
In fact, if you are looking for a relaxing time in the U.S. Virgin Islands, and to immerse yourself in true, natural, unspoilt surroundings, then St. John stands out as the obvious choice. With around two-thirds of the Island designated as National Park, it is the most undeveloped, easygoing and laid back of the large U.S. Virgin Islands. Of special note, and something which is not to be missed, is the Virgin Islands National Park, which offers visitors a special opportunity to enjoy and appreciate the beautiful natural resources of the island. It includes hiking trails and a wonderful range of wildlife, some of which is unique to St. John. The beaches within it, which are open to the public, are amongst the best to be found in the U.S. Virgin Islands.
Staying in either Cruz Bay or Coral Bay, which are the two main towns on the Island, allows easy access to restaurants and shops. There are lots of hotels and resorts to choose from, which range from the quaint to the exceedingly lavish. Booking early is always advisable as finding somewhere to stay at the last minute is normally impossible, especially in the peak season.
